Abstract

Abstract: In this paper, first of all define a new function namely Hyper-geometric Kiran Function which is generalization of Hyper-geometric Function then a relation between Dirichlet average of Hyper-geometric Kiran function and fractional derivative is established.

Mathematics Subject Classification: 26A33, 33A30, 33A25 and 83C99.

Keywords and Phrases: Dirichlet average, Hyper-geometric Kiran function Hyper-geometric function, fractional derivative and Fractional calculus operators
